The Normal CornBelters take out the Washington Wild Things with help from McKenna, 4-3

Patrick McKenna went 1-2, sparking the Normal CornBelters (5-3) to a 4-3 victory over the Washington Wild Things (1-7) on Saturday at The Corn Crib.

He singled in the first inning.

Kevin Brahney picked up the win for the Normal CornBelters. Brahney allowed one earned run, four hits and one walk while striking out four over six innings of work.

C.J. Beatty had two extra-base hits for the Washington Wild Things. He doubled in the fourth inning and homered in the eighth inning.

Kyle Helisek couldn't get it done on the bump for the Washington Wild Things, taking a loss. He lasted just five innings, walked three, struck out four, and allowed two runs.
